For ten years, Professor Klaus-Dieter Barbknecht has led TU Bergakademie Freiberg. 20 July 2025 will be his last day as Rector of the university, from which he bid farewell in small circles and in an informal exchange with university members instead of a formal ceremony.

Professor Klaus-Dieter Barbknecht took office in 2015 and was re-elected as Rector of TUBAF in 2020. Throughout crises, Rector Barbknecht worked together with the university staff in a spirit of continuous trust - he himself describes his time at TUBAF as "the best years of my professional life". Regionally anchored and internationally networked, TUBAF jointly tackled research topics of high technological and social relevance during his tenure and generated new knowledge at particularly exciting interfaces.

Joint success that resonates

During these years, the TU Bergakademie Freiberg campus changed significantly for all to see: the Schlossplatzquartier was completed, modern buildings for research, teaching and the university library were built on the science corridor and in the northern part of the campus.

In terms of teaching staff/professors, Rector Barbknecht's time in office has been characterised by a generational change. Within ten years, almost 70% of today's almost 100 professors were newly appointed.

Other milestones include the progressive internationalisation of the university, its increasing third-party funding and pronounced transfer activities, which can be seen in the 80 spin-offs in the last ten years

In a video, Rector Barbknecht thanks the university members and hopes that his successor, Professor Jutta Emes, will experience the same support, loyalty and cooperation that he has received over the past ten years.
